device property: Move fwnode_connection_find_match() under drivers/base/property.c
authorHeikki Krogerus <heikki.krogerus@linux.intel.com>
Mon, 7 Sep 2020 12:05:31 +0000 (15:05 +0300)
committerGreg Kroah-Hartman <gregkh@linuxfoundation.org>
Tue, 8 Sep 2020 11:32:06 +0000 (13:32 +0200)
The function is now only a helper that searches the
connection from device graph and then by checking if the
supplied connection identifier matches a property that
contains reference.

+/**
+ * fwnode_connection_find_match - Find connection from a device node
+ * @fwnode: Device node with the connection
+ * @con_id: Identifier for the connection
+ * @data: Data for the match function
+ * @match: Function to check and convert the connection description
+ *
+ * Find a connection with unique identifier @con_id between @fwnode and another
+ * device node. @match will be used to convert the connection description to
+ * data the caller is expecting to be returned.
+ */
+void *fwnode_connection_find_match(struct fwnode_handle *fwnode,
+                                  const char *con_id, void *data,
+                                  devcon_match_fn_t match)
+{
+       void *ret;
+
+       if (!fwnode || !match)
+               return NULL;
+
+       ret = fwnode_graph_devcon_match(fwnode, con_id, data, match);
+       if (ret)
+               return ret;
+
+       return fwnode_devcon_match(fwnode, con_id, data, match);
+}
+EXPORT_SYMBOL_GPL(fwnode_connection_find_match);
